Match Column-I with Column-II.

Column-I Column-II (a) Fundamental Quantity (i) Area (b) Derived Quantity (ii) Mass (c) Base Unit (iii) Time (d) SI Unit of Speed (iv) m s –1

Choose the correct matching:

A

a-ii, b-i, c-iii, d-iv

B

a-i, b-ii, c-iii, d-iv

C

a-ii, b-iv, c-i, d-iii

D

a-iii, b-ii, c-i, d-iv

Correct Answer

Option A

Detailed Explanation

Fundamental quantities such as mass and time are not derived from other quantities, while derived quantities like area are based on fundamental ones. The SI unit of speed is indeed m s –1, confirming the correct matches in option A.
